The West Virginia University School of Dentistry offers a Doctor of Dental Surgery, a Bachelor of Science in Dental Hygiene, and advanced education programs in Endodontics, Orthodontics, Periodontics, Prosthodontics, and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ery. Why should you choose WVU dental hygiene?
🦷 Earn a 4-year degree as opposed to a 2-year degree.
🦷 Your class will include fewer than 30 classmates.
🦷Low faculty-to-student ratio in classes, labs and clinic
🦷Spend 6 semesters providing direct patient care.
🦷Eight weeks of patient care experience in rural care area
🦷Graduate with research experience.
🦷Get straight work. 74% of students have jobs before they graduate.
Bachelor of Science Dental Hygiene | School of Dentistry | West Virginia University Our four-year program prepares our graduates to be the best qualified and most experienced hygienists entering the work force today.

Our Story
(For patient care, search WVU Dental Care.)
The West Virginia University School of Dentistry – the state’s only dental school – has been a leader in dental education, research, and patient care for more than five decades.
Each year, more than 300 students are enrolled in our undergraduate and post-graduate programs. We provide future generations of dental hygienists, general dentists, and dental specialists with the cutting-edge skills they need to provide the highest quality care to their patients. About 80 percent of all dentists and 25 percent of all dental hygienists practicing in West Virginia are graduates of the WVU School of Dentistry.
Our faculty and students provide general dentistry and specialty care to thousands of patients each year.
